About six months ago I took our dogs to a local big-name chain pet store to have them both groomed. I didn’t have the time or energy to do it myself, and they really needed it. I usually take care of the grooming personally, but it just wasn’t going to happen. Anyway, I paid about eighty dollars (if I recall correctly) and they did a fair job. I thought that they had done a good job until I got home and found that they neglected to groom out the left hindquarter of one of the dog – it was still a mess! So I had to groom that part myself.
Anyway, yesterday I got home from running errands and found a message on my answering machine from that store that there were calling to remind me of the appointment on Monday to have both of my dogs groomed again! Well, I had never made another appointment for that, and after checking with my wife, we decided that we needed to give the pet store a call. The woman that answered the phone agreed to cancel the appointment and told me that they just always schedule another appointment for the dogs even if we didn’t ask for one! I think that is a sleazy thing to do! I can understand a courtesy call/reminder that it had been six months since the last grooming, and asking the owner to call to make an appointment, but to actually make it without the owner’s consent, well that is just wrong.

There have been a lot of hang-up calls coming in on our home phone lately. My wife tells me that the hang-up calls are from a telemarketing company. I told her that I didn’t think that makes any sense at all since no one was trying to sell me anything! Then she claimed that there are companies that have their computers robo-call telephones and mark down if someone was home to answer the phone or not.
They use this information to create a list of when the best time is to call the house and then sell that list to companies that will really have someone call to try to sell us stuff. I thought that we were on the “do not call” registry, but maybe it’s expired. I think I’ll check it out and see if we are still on there. I don’t like getting these kinds of calls – sometimes I’m napping and it wakes me up, which is very aggravating!
